WCAG Level AAA requires a contrast ratio of at least 7:1 for normal text and 4.5:1 for large text. Large text is defined as 14 point (typically 18.66px) and bold or larger, or 18 point (typically 24px) or larger. Digital Accessibility Services provides resources and assistance to those producing digital content, acquiring or building digital products, ...WAVE is a web accessibility evaluation tool developed by WebAIM.org. It provides visual feedback about the accessibility of your web content by injecting icons and indicators into your page. No automated tool can tell you if your page is accessible, but WAVE facilitates human evaluation and educates about accessibility issues.A screen reader is a piece of software on a computer, smartphone or tablet which converts text to audio. WAVE is developed and made available as a free community service by WebAIM at Utah State University. Originally launched in 2001, WAVE has been used to evaluate the accessibility of millions of web pages. It is also … Institute for Disability Research, Policy & Practice One solution is to provide a non-link character between each link. The vertical bar ( | ) is used quite often for this purpose. Another solution is to put the links in an ordered or numbered list. Screen readers tend to pause between list items, helping the user audibly distinguish between separate links.While WebAIM supports the civil rights of individuals with disabilities to access web content, and provides services to help organizations implement accessibility, WAVE cannot provide a good measure of discrimination.
